Embodiment 1

[0013] Take a commercially available high-purity CPP product, use Chelex-100 to remove the calcium in the CPP product, and then use deionized water to prepare a CPP solution with a concentration of 100 mg / mL, take 3.75 mL, stir at room temperature for 10 minutes, and then add PH=8.0 Stir 5mL potassium dihydrogen phosphate and potassium hydrogen phosphate buffer solution evenly, then add 1.25mL calcium chloride solution with a concentration of 100mg / mL and mix evenly, let the solution stand at 25°C for 40 minutes until the precipitation is fully produced, then in Centrifuge at 2900rpm for 20 minutes to remove the precipitate in the solution, then the supernatant contains calcium ions complexed with CPP. The calcium content in the supernatant was detected by an atomic absorption spectrometer, and the amount of calcium ions that CPP at this concentration could bind was converted. It has been determined that the calcium holding capacity of the CCP product is 74.7mg / 100mg.

Embodiment 2

[0015] Take a commercially available low-purity CPP product, use Chelex-100 to remove the calcium in the CPP product, and then prepare a CPP solution with a concentration of 100 mg / mL with deionized water, take 3.75 mL, stir at room temperature for 10 minutes, and then add PH=8.0 Stir 5mL potassium dihydrogen phosphate and potassium hydrogen phosphate buffer solution evenly, then add 1.25mL calcium chloride solution with a concentration of 100mg / mL and mix evenly, let the solution stand at 25°C for 40 minutes until the precipitation is fully produced, then in Centrifuge at 2900rpm for 20 minutes to remove the precipitate in the solution, then the supernatant contains calcium ions complexed with CPP. The calcium content in the supernatant was detected by an atomic absorption spectrometer, and the amount of calcium ions that CPP at this concentration could bind was converted. It has been determined that the calcium holding capacity of the CCP product is 19.4mg / 100mg.

Abstract

The invention relates to a method for detecting calcium retention capability of casein phosphopeptides products, belonging to the field of food additives and detection methods of the food additives. The method for detecting calcium retention capability of casein phosphopeptides product comprises the following steps: removing calcium in CPP products by Chelex-100, adding deionized water and preparing the CPP products into a CPP solution with a certain concentration, stirring at the room temperature for 10 minutes, adding 5mL of a buffer solution prepared from monopotassium phosphate and potassium hydrogen phosphate with a pH value of 8.0 and uniformly stirring, then adding calcium chloride solution and uniformly mixing, standing the solution at 25 DEG C for 40 minutes until sediment is fully generated, subsequently centrifuging for 20 minutes at 2900rpm to remove the sediment in the solution, wherein the supernate contains calcium ions complexed with CPP; detecting the content of calcium in the supernate by virtue of an atomic absorption spectrometer and calculating the quantity of the calcium ions complexed with CPP with the certain concentration. The detection method has the characteristics of being simple and quick, high in sensitivity, high in reproducibility and accurate and reliable in result, therefore, the detection method can be applied to rapid and conventional analysis and detection of the calcium retention capability of casein phosphopeptides products.

Description

technical field [0001] The invention relates to a method for measuring the calcium holding capacity of a casein phosphopeptide product, and belongs to the field of food additives and detection methods thereof. Background technique [0002] Casein phosphopeptide (CPP for short) is an active peptide product obtained from bovine casein through enzymatic hydrolysis, separation and purification. Studies have found that CPP can combine with calcium ions to form a stable soluble complex, thereby preventing or delaying the formation of calcium ions in a neutral or weakly alkaline environment. The ability of CPP to bind calcium is closely related to factors such as the composition and sequence of amino acids in the molecule or the distribution of phosphate groups. Among them, the nitrogen / phosphorus molar ratio (N / P) of CPP products can objectively reflect the physical and chemical properties of CPP products such as purity, phosphate group density, and calcium binding capacity.
